Ajuda do Collabora Office 24.04
Converte uma string ou expressão numérica em um inteiro.
CInt (Expression As Variant) As Integer
Integer
Se o argumento for string, a função corta o espaço em branco à esquerda; em seguida, ela tenta reconhecer números nos caracteres seguintes. As sintaxes abaixo são reconhecidas:
Números decimais (com sinal opcional na frente) usando separadores decimais e separadores de grupo configurados para a localidade no Collabora Office (separadores de grupo são aceitos em qualquer posição), com notação exponencial opcional da forma "-12e+1" (onde um número decimal inteiro com sinal opcional após e ou E ou d ou D, define a potência de 10);
Números octais como "&Onnn...", onde "nnn..." depois de "&O" ou "&o" é uma sequência de até 11 dígitos, de 0 a 7, até o próximo caractere não alfanumérico;
Números hexadecimais como "&Hnnn...", onde "nnn..." depois de "&H" ou "&h" é a sequência de caracteres até o próximo caractere não alfanumérico e não deve ter mais de 8 dígitos, de 0 a 9, A a F ou a a f.
O resto da string é ignorado. Se a string não for reconhecida, por exemplo, quando depois de cortar o espaço em branco inicial, ela não começar com sinal de mais, menos, um dígito decimal ou "&", ou quando a sequência após "&O" tiver mais de 11 caracteres ou contiver um caractere alfabético, o valor numérico da expressão é 0 .
Se um argumento é um erro, o número do erro é usado como um valor numérico da expressão.
Se o argumento for uma data, o número de dias desde 1899-12-30 (data serial) é usado como um valor numérico da expressão. A hora é representada como fração de um dia.
Após calcular o valor numérico da expressão, esse é arredondado para o número inteiro mais próximo (se necessário) e se o resultado não for entre -32768 e 32767, o Collabora Office Basic reporta um erro de overflow. Caso contrário, retorna o resultado.